in|situ| News
- CHI 2012 best paper award for Using Rhythmic Patterns as an Input Method - E. Ghomi, G. Faure, S. Huot, O. Chapuis and M. Beaudouin-Lafon, and honorable mention for Evaluating the Benefits of Real-time Feedback in Mobile Augmented Reality with Hand-held Devices - C. Liu, S. Huot, J. Diehl, W. Mackay and M. Beaudouin-Lafon.
- in|situ| members co-author 4 full papers and 2 notes at CHI 2012.
- UIST 2011 notable mention award for Cracking the Cocoa Nut: User Interface Programming at Runtime - James Eagan, Wendy Mackay and Michel Beaudouin-Lafon.
- Michel Beaudouin-Lafon has been nominated as a senior member of the Institut Universitaire de France.
- Anastasia Bezerianos (Associate Professor at Univ. Paris-Sud) joins the in|situ| faculty.
- CHI 2011 best paper award for Mid-air Pan-and-Zoom on Wall-sized Displays - M. Nancel, J. Wagner, E. Pietriga, O. Chapuis and W. Mackay.
- Claude Puech (Professor at Univ. Paris-Sud) and Theophanis Tsandilas (CR2 at INRIA) join the in|situ| faculty.
- Lancement de l'étude iPad.
- IHM 2009 best paper award for FlowStates - Caroline Appert, Stéphane Huot, Pierre Dragicevic and Michel Beaudouin-Lafon.
- Hélène Milome? (Administrative Assistant) joins the in|situ| lab.
- Installed since February, the WILD platform was officially opened on June 19 2009 (details here: WILD Inauguration).
- James R Eagan (Post-Doc), Clément Pillias? and Romain Primet (Research Engineers) join the in|situ| lab.
- Wendy Mackay has been elected to the CHI Academy.
- in|situ| members co-author 6 full papers and 1 note at CHI 2009.
- 2 new Ph.D students joined the lab: Emilien Ghomi and Mathieu Nancel.
- Caroline Appert (CR2 at CNRS) joins the in|situ| faculty.
